CPR-16: HOLY SONS “Lost Decade II” LP + DIGITAL DOWNLOAD Hidden away in a virtual cave during the 90’s, Emil Amos (Om, Grails, Lilacs & Champagne) amassed a catalog of over 1000 songs, never submitting any of them to a label or playing live. The Brooklyn Sessions Following a long year of touring with the Beastie Boys on the Licensed to Ill tour, Tom and Adam Yauch decided that they would do something different.
